win10内存泄露怎么判断

1.win10内存泄漏

引起内存泄漏可能是由于一些软件进程,或者是驱动程序。所以没有必要一定重装系统.

排查方法:

1,打开任务管理器,切换到“详细信息”选项卡

2,在进程列表顶部的表头(即“名称”、“pid”、“状态”等这一行字)上点击右键,选择“选择列”

3,选中“工作集(内存)”和“工作集增量(内存)”这两项

4,随后进程列表中会显示这两个新增的参数

5,在列表顶部的表头处点击新添加的这两列的名称,按照对应数值的大小进行降序排列

6,看看这两项降序排列后,排名靠前的分别是什么进程。

检测到什么进程后,再尝试关闭这些进程,或找到进程对应的程序解决。

驱动问题尝试更新所有驱动程序,包括网卡驱动。看内存泄漏问题是否解决。

2.平板win10系统内存泄漏,怎么定位内存泄漏的程序

如果能够打开任务管理器,可以先看看进程选项卡里面的进程

在查看→选择列 中选择内存专用工作集 工作集两个

然后按从大到小排序

观察那些不断增长的进程,记录下名字

并干掉它们

再观察是否仍然继续增长

如果没有,尝试卸载那些程序(可以在没有杀死进程之前,右键,打开程序位置,找到程序源头)

另外不排除有一些是由服务导致的

记录正在运行的服务,尝试关闭那些可疑的服务

观察内存使用量

找到可疑服务后,禁用服务,然后重启,看看会不会解决问题

3.windows 怎么检查内存泄漏

Windows 内存诊断程序可以诊断内存泄漏,它会测试计算机随机存取内存(RAM)是否存在错误,包括一组综合性的内存测试。

Windows 内存诊断程序容易使用并且速度快,如果运行 Windows 遇到了问题,可以使用此诊断程序查清问题是否由损坏的硬件所导致的。 还有一个很简单的办法来检查一个程序是否有内存泄漏。

就是是用Windows的任务管理器(Task Manager)。运行程序,然后在任务管理器里面查看 “内存使用”和”虚拟内存大小”两项,当程序请求了它所需要的内存之后,如果虚拟内存还是持续的增长的话,就说明了这个程序有内存泄漏问题。

当然如果内存泄漏的数目非常的小,用这种方法可能要过很长时间才能看的出来。

4.如何检测内存泄漏

内存泄漏指由于疏忽或错误造成程序未能释放已经不再使用的内存的情况。

内存泄漏并非指内存在物理上的消失,而是应用程序分配某段内存后,由于设计错误,失去了对该段内存的控制,因而造成了内存的浪费。可以使用相应的软件测试工具对软件进行检测。

1. ccmalloc——Linux和Solaris下对C和C++程序的简单的使用内存泄漏和malloc调试库。2. Dmalloc——Debug Malloc Library.3. Electric Fence——Linux分发版中由Bruce Perens编写的malloc()调试库。

4. Leaky——Linux下检测内存泄漏的程序。5. LeakTracer——Linux、Solaris和HP-UX下跟踪和分析C++程序中的内存泄漏。

6. MEMWATCH——由Johan Lindh编写,是一个开放源代码C语言内存错误检测工具,主要是通过gcc的precessor来进行。7. Valgrind——Debugging and profiling Linux programs, aiming at programs written in C and C++.8. KCachegrind——A visualization tool for the profiling data generated by Cachegrind and Calltree.9. Leak Monitor——一个Firefox扩展,能找出跟Firefox相关的泄漏类型。

10. IE Leak Detector (Drip/IE Sieve)——Drip和IE Sieve leak detectors帮助网页开发员提升动态网页性能通过报告可避免的因为IE局限的内存泄漏。11. Windows Leaks Detector——探测任何Win32应用程序中的任何资源泄漏(内存,句柄等),基于Win API调用钩子。

12. SAP Memory Analyzer——是一款开源的JAVA内存分析软件,可用于辅助查找JAVA程序的内存泄漏,能容易找到大块内存并验证谁在一直占用它,它是基于Eclipse RCP(Rich Client Platform),可以下载RCP的独立版本或者Eclipse的插件。13. DTrace——即动态跟踪Dynamic Tracing,是一款开源软件,能在Unix类似平台运行,用户能够动态检测操作系统内核和用户进程,以更精确地掌握系统的资源使用状况,提高系统性能,减少支持成本,并进行有效的调节。

14. IBM Rational PurifyPlus——帮助开发人员查明C/C++、托管。NET、Java和VB6代码中的性能和可靠性错误。

PurifyPlus 将内存错误和泄漏检测、应用程序性能描述、代码覆盖分析等功能组合在一个单一、完整的工具包中。15. Parasoft Insure++——针对C/C++应用的运行时错误自动检测工具,它能够自动监测C/C++程序,发现其中存在着的内存破坏、内存泄漏、指针错误和I/O等错误。

并通过使用一系列独特的技术(SCI技术和变异测试等),彻底的检查和测试我们的代码,精确定位错误的准确位置并给出详细的诊断信息。能作为Microsoft Visual C++的一个插件运行。

16. Compuware DevPartner for Visual C++ BoundsChecker Suite——为C++开发者设计的运行错误检测和调试工具软件。作为Microsoft Visual Studio和C++ 6.0的一个插件运行。

17. Electric Software GlowCode——包括内存泄漏检查,code profiler,函数调用跟踪等功能。给C++和。

Net开发者提供完整的错误诊断,和运行时性能分析工具包。18. Compuware DevPartner Java Edition——包含Java内存检测,代码覆盖率测试,代码性能测试,线程死锁,分布式应用等几大功能模块。

19. Quest JProbe——分析Java的内存泄漏。20. ej-technologies JProfiler——一个全功能的Java剖析工具,专用于分析J2SE和J2EE应用程序。

它把CPU、执行绪和内存的剖析组合在一个强大的应用中。JProfiler可提供许多IDE整合和应用服务器整合用途。

JProfiler直觉式的GUI让你可以找到效能瓶颈、抓出内存泄漏、并解决执行绪的问题。4.3.2注册码:A-G666#76114F-1olm9mv1i5uuly#012621. BEA JRockit——用来诊断Java内存泄漏并指出根本原因,专门针对Intel平台并得到优化,能在Intel硬件上获得最高的性能。

22. SciTech Software AB .NET Memory Profiler——找到内存泄漏并优化内存使用针对C#,VB.Net,或其它。Net程序。

23. YourKit .NET & Java Profiler——业界领先的Java和。NET程序性能分析工具。

24. AutomatedQA AQTime——AutomatedQA的获奖产品performance profiling和memory debugging工具集的下一代替换产品,支持Microsoft, Borland, Intel, Compaq 和 GNU编译器。可以为。

NET和Windows程序生成全面细致的报告,从而帮助您轻松隔离并排除代码中含有的性能问题和内存/资源泄露问题。支持。

Net1.0,1.1,2.0,3.0和Windows 32/64位应用程序。25. JavaScript Memory Leak Detector——微软全球产品开发欧洲团队(Global Product Development- Europe team, GPDE) 发布的一款调试工具,用来探测JavaScript代码中的内存泄漏,运行为IE系列的一个插件。

5.win10内存泄漏

任务管理器点击“进程”那一页,点一下“内存”那一栏,进程会按内存占用从大到小排列,这时你就可以在内存占用前几名里找到问题进程,如下图,从而锁定问题程序,卸载或者升级即可解决问题。以前我遇到QQ浏览器beta版的内存溢出bug,通过相同的方法,锁定了qq浏览器这个程序,卸载后换回稳定版就解决了。你也可以参考此方法解决其它程序内存溢出问题。

win10内存泄露怎么判断

转载请注明出处windows之家 » win10内存泄露怎么判断

win10

win10平板怎么取消手势

阅读(215)

本文主要为您介绍win10平板怎么取消手势,内容包括win10平板怎么关闭手势操作,win10平板怎么修改或关闭边缘滑动手势,win10平板怎么关闭手势操作。显示桌面:三个手指同时在触控板向下滑动,所有窗口最小化,显示桌面。等同于鼠标点击桌面右下角。

win10

黑鲨装机工具怎么激活win10

阅读(233)

本文主要为您介绍黑鲨装机工具怎么激活win10,内容包括请问,靠自己用黑鲨安装的Windows10家庭版如何激活,告诉你怎么使用黑鲨重装win10系统,win10系统用黑鲨重装以后还激活的吗。1.开机按F2键进入该BIOS设置界面,选择高级BIOS设置:Advanced BI

win10

华硕win10删了系统文件怎么办

阅读(189)

本文主要为您介绍华硕win10删了系统文件怎么办,内容包括win10删了系统文件怎么恢复,win10不小心卸载了系统文件怎么办,win10误删系统文件怎么恢复。点击桌面左下角的window徽标,如图所示在弹出的菜单,点击“所有应用”找到“Windows系统”里

win10

win10linux双系统怎么切换

阅读(249)

本文主要为您介绍win10linux双系统怎么切换,内容包括我是win10和liunx双系统,我每次启动都是liunx系统怎么切换回win10,开机时win10和ubuntu双系统怎么切换,开机时win10和ubuntu双系统怎么切换。双系统的切换步骤如下:在“我的电脑”桌面,用

win10

Win10怎么调灯光

阅读(248)

本文主要为您介绍Win10怎么调灯光,内容包括Win10夜灯模式怎样设置,Win10夜灯怎么用Win10夜灯设置方法,win10怎么设置屏幕色温。进入设置-系统;2、打开显示界面,在右侧底部点击【高级显示设置】3、拖动到下面找到【颜色设置】,在下面点击 颜色

win10

Win10系统怎么自动加载盘符

阅读(180)

本文主要为您介绍Win10系统怎么自动加载盘符,内容包括Win10如何在开机是自动加载虚拟磁盘,Windows10系统启动时无法自动加载磁盘分区,怎么解决,如何加载WIN10下的NTFS的盘符了。右击这台电脑(我的电脑)选择管理,在左侧的列表中选择磁盘管理。2

win10

win10专业版有两个账户怎么删除一个

阅读(159)

本文主要为您介绍win10专业版有两个账户怎么删除一个,内容包括win10登录有两个账户,怎么删除一个既要密码也要账号的,win10开机有两个用户怎么取消一个,win10电脑开机时有两个账号,怎么删除一个。操作步骤如下:按下windwos+R快捷键打开运行

win10

win10怎么删除微信登录记录

阅读(216)

本文主要为您介绍win10怎么删除微信登录记录,内容包括怎么删除windows10的历史记录,windows10怎么消除历史记录,win10怎么删除自己登录的账户。win10 设置→隐私

win10

win10按w切换应用程序错误怎么办

阅读(159)

本文主要为您介绍win10按w切换应用程序错误怎么办,内容包括win10应用程序的错误怎么解决,win10应用程序的错误怎么解决,win10windows登录应用程序错误怎么解决。步骤如下:按下“Win+R”组合键打开运行,在匡中输入:gepdit.msc 点击确定打开组策

win10

win10怎么对盘加密

阅读(150)

本文主要为您介绍win10怎么对盘加密,内容包括win10家庭版怎么给电脑硬盘加密,Win10系统下怎样对磁盘进行加密,解密,win10怎么给硬盘加密。我们右键此电脑,选择最下面的属性。2看最左上角,有个“控制面板主页”,点击进入控制面板界面。进去后,看

win10

win10怎么推荐给别人

阅读(142)

本文主要为您介绍win10怎么推荐给别人,内容包括Win10正式版热点开启方法Win10怎么共享热点,win10有啥推荐的功能,看起来比较酷炫,Win10正式版如何开启wifi热点Win10怎么共享wifi热点。右击Win10正式版左下角的“Windows”按钮,从其右键菜单

win10

怎么停止win10自动装驱动

阅读(122)

本文主要为您介绍怎么停止win10自动装驱动,内容包括win10怎么关闭系统自动安装驱动,怎么关闭win10自动安装显卡驱动,win10怎么关闭系统自动安装驱动。操作方法第一步、对着桌面这台电脑图标单击鼠标右键,菜单中点击“属性”。第二步、在系统

win10

怎么永久关掉win10的自动更新

阅读(287)

本文主要为您介绍怎么永久关掉win10的自动更新,内容包括怎样永久关闭Win10自动更新,怎么永久彻底关闭Windows10的自动更新,如何永久关闭WIN10系统自动更新。打开电脑,鼠标右键”我的电脑“,点击管理(或打开控制面板,双击管理工具)在管理工具里面

win10

win10出现代码56怎么解决

阅读(250)

本文主要为您介绍win10出现代码56怎么解决,内容包括window仍在设置比设备的类配置代码56,win10,wind10系统出现irqlnotlessorequal蓝屏怎么简易处理,Win10专业版新装Step75.6或者Step75.6sp1,打开参考数据弹出。解决办法是重新安装win10系

win10

win10平板怎么取消手势

阅读(215)

本文主要为您介绍win10平板怎么取消手势,内容包括win10平板怎么关闭手势操作,win10平板怎么修改或关闭边缘滑动手势,win10平板怎么关闭手势操作。显示桌面:三个手指同时在触控板向下滑动,所有窗口最小化,显示桌面。等同于鼠标点击桌面右下角。

win10

黑鲨装机工具怎么激活win10

阅读(233)

本文主要为您介绍黑鲨装机工具怎么激活win10,内容包括请问,靠自己用黑鲨安装的Windows10家庭版如何激活,告诉你怎么使用黑鲨重装win10系统,win10系统用黑鲨重装以后还激活的吗。1.开机按F2键进入该BIOS设置界面,选择高级BIOS设置:Advanced BI

win10

华硕win10删了系统文件怎么办

阅读(189)

本文主要为您介绍华硕win10删了系统文件怎么办,内容包括win10删了系统文件怎么恢复,win10不小心卸载了系统文件怎么办,win10误删系统文件怎么恢复。点击桌面左下角的window徽标,如图所示在弹出的菜单,点击“所有应用”找到“Windows系统”里

win10

win10linux双系统怎么切换

阅读(249)

本文主要为您介绍win10linux双系统怎么切换,内容包括我是win10和liunx双系统,我每次启动都是liunx系统怎么切换回win10,开机时win10和ubuntu双系统怎么切换,开机时win10和ubuntu双系统怎么切换。双系统的切换步骤如下:在“我的电脑”桌面,用

win10

Win10怎么调灯光

阅读(248)

本文主要为您介绍Win10怎么调灯光,内容包括Win10夜灯模式怎样设置,Win10夜灯怎么用Win10夜灯设置方法,win10怎么设置屏幕色温。进入设置-系统;2、打开显示界面,在右侧底部点击【高级显示设置】3、拖动到下面找到【颜色设置】,在下面点击 颜色

win10

Win10系统怎么自动加载盘符

阅读(180)

本文主要为您介绍Win10系统怎么自动加载盘符,内容包括Win10如何在开机是自动加载虚拟磁盘,Windows10系统启动时无法自动加载磁盘分区,怎么解决,如何加载WIN10下的NTFS的盘符了。右击这台电脑(我的电脑)选择管理,在左侧的列表中选择磁盘管理。2

win10

win10专业版有两个账户怎么删除一个

阅读(159)

本文主要为您介绍win10专业版有两个账户怎么删除一个,内容包括win10登录有两个账户,怎么删除一个既要密码也要账号的,win10开机有两个用户怎么取消一个,win10电脑开机时有两个账号,怎么删除一个。操作步骤如下:按下windwos+R快捷键打开运行

win10

win10剪贴板怎么查看

阅读(204)

本文主要为您介绍win10剪贴板怎么查看,内容包括怎么找到剪贴板的内容win10,如何查看win10电脑上的剪切板内容,怎么查看Win10剪切板中的内容。方法步骤如下:首先打开计算机,在计算机内找到“设置”选项并使用鼠标点击。